In the same concept as the chair (Eight), Jin Kuramoto and CondeHouse developed this round table. The table made of Hokkaido wood obviously looks bold in design. It is composed of the top board of 34 mm in thick and a column-shaped center leg. The tapered leg shape is not only for design purposes but makes more space for the toes. The plain design can go with various chairs, and the top board and leg are available in different finishes, which makes the table more acceptable in public spaces as well.

Jin Kuramoto, born in 1976, established "JINKURAMOTO STUDIO" in Tokyo in 2008 after working as a product designer for a major electronics manufacturer for about 10 years. He is good at expressig the concept or story of a product in its design clearly, working in the wide variety of projects such as electronics, eye wears, and cars both domestically and internationally. His design style is always experimental. Until ideas are shaped in his mind, he always keeps on touching material phisicaly and making a lot of trials and errors in his studio that is full of inspiration.
